Balcony installation projects in Santa Ana, CA, can vary widely depending on design preferences, building structure, and local regulations. Understanding the typical elements involved can help in planning and budgeting for a new balcony addition or upgrade.
- Materials: Common options include treated wood, steel, aluminum, or concrete, each with different durability and aesthetic qualities suitable for Southern California climates.
- Size and Scope: Projects range from small Juliet balconies to larger, multi-tiered balconies, depending on the building's structure and available space.
- Labor Complexity: Installation complexity varies based on building type, height, and existing structure, influencing the overall effort required.
- Permitting: Local permits may be necessary to ensure compliance with Santa Ana building codes and safety standards, especially for larger or structural modifications.
- Extras: Additional features such as railings, lighting, decorative elements, or waterproofing can be included to enhance functionality and appearance.
Project size and scope influence overall expenses.
| Scope/Size | Typical Range |
|---|---|
| Small balcony (e.g., 4x4 ft) | $3,000 - $6,000 |
| Medium balcony (e.g., 6x8 ft) | $6,000 - $12,000 |
| Larger balcony (e.g., 10x12 ft) | $12,000 - $25,000 |
| Structural modifications (if needed) | $2,000 - $8,000 |
| Additional features (e.g., railings, finishes) | $1,000 - $5,000 |
